The Clinical Study At A Glance: 16 Patients, Compelling Efficacy

The trial focused on patients suffering from advanced senile vascular dementia—a condition caused by damaged blood vessels that restrict oxygen flow to the brain, leading to rapid cell death, memory loss, and severe cognitive impairment. Traditional treatments fail because they only attempt to manage symptoms. This trial aimed directly at the structural root causes using a triple-dose protocol of allogeneic hUC-MSCs.

Clinical Parameter

Trial Metric / Protocol Details

Patient Cohort

16 Human Cases with Diagnosed Senile Vascular Dementia

Therapeutic Material

Human Umbilical Cord Mesenchymal Stem Cells (hUC-MSCs)

Delivery Mechanism

Targeted Intravenous (IV) Infusion Pipeline

Dosing Schedule

3 Separate Sequential Transfusions

Primary Metrics Tracked

Mini-Mental State Examination (MMSE) & Activities of Daily Living (ADL)

How hUC-MSCs Heal the Dementia-Stricken Brain

When delivered through an advanced IV protocol, umbilical cord stem cells home in directly on structural tissue injuries via the circulatory system. Once in proximity to the neurovascular units of the brain, they exert their therapeutic effects through three main mechanisms:

  1. Resolving Severe Neuroinflammation: Chronic dementia forces the brain's resident immune cells (microglia) into a destructive, hyper-activated state. The hUC-MSCs trigger a cellular "phenotypic switch," converting these angry immune cells back into protective, healing agents.

  2. Neovascularization (Restoring Blood Supply): By secreting potent growth factors like Vascular Endothelial Growth Factor (VEGF), the stem cell secretome prompts the growth of new, healthy capillary networks around damaged brain tissues, restoring vital oxygen and glucose delivery.

  3. Preventing Neuronal Death: The cellular cargo directly delivers anti-apoptotic (cell-protecting) signals to threatened brain cells, halting the rapid neural loss that characterizes Alzheimer's and vascular dementia.
